Fatal Love

After being thrown out of the police academy, Debbie Fung (Ellen Chan) gets a new chance but instead the proposition is to go undercover. Accepting the mission to get close to tycoon Lau Fuk Tin (Michael Wong) as he's suspected of a number of murders of women, under the disguise of Maryanne, Debbie quickly gets close to Lau. Going so far as getting almost permanent residence with the man, Debbie witness horrific things on the grounds. Despite, affection starting to develop towards her target.

All Mighty Gambler

Yan Chi Yung (Chin Siu Ho) joins his fellow triad member Chu Chi Ang (Norman Tsui) in ripping off millions in gambling profits from their underworld boss Tai (Chen Kuan Tai), returning most of it after taking some for themselves. Meanwhile, a sexy gambler named Ice Chan (Ellen Chan), whose father was murdered by Tai several years before, arrives from America looking for revenge. She tries to infiltrate Tai's organization by seducing Yan, but really falls for him and fails in her attempt to assassinate Tai behind his back. More trickery and double-crosses follow as Tai tries to get Yan and Chu to help him rip off another gambler, only to have his plans thwarted by a turncoat within his own gang.

Biography

Ellen Chan Nga-Lun (Chinese: 陳雅倫) is a Hong Kong actress. From 1985 to 1992, Chen Yalun performed a lot of movies and some TV series, but the star route was not outstanding. In 1993, in order to break through the performing arts career, she took the first Category III film "Fatal Love" and sang the theme song "Meng Liren" in the movie. In the same year, she launched the first adult photo album. In 1994, she signed a contract with Xinli Records to launch the Cantonese-language record.
